Hi Milly, I can ony help you with the pets part of your message. I relocated to South Tenerife two months ago with my two cats. You just need to get together a pet passport for each pet, your vet will have all the necessary details. 24-36 hours before you travel with them you need to visit the vet to get an all clear on their health, the vet will then stamp the passport.
I came out from Gatwick with BA, if you ring them, telephone number is on their website, they are very helpful and will advise you what you have to do. You pay approx £11 per kilo of animal and animal transporter. You book in with your pet at the same time same time and you book yourself in. I also had a quote from Monarch from Gatwick, their charge ws three times that of BA! and you had to leave the animals in the north terminal cargo centre three hours before you travel.
Hope this helps a little, if I can help further plese contact me.
